5k Eritreans estimated to flee EACH MONTH & 22% of asylum seekers arriving in Europe were Eritrean, 2nd only to Syrians even though the latter have 6x the population of Eritrea.

This is 8 years ago. Things have only gotten exponentially worse.

In this @AJEnglish analysis by Shola Lawal, Raesetje Sefala discusses what she has found through our spatial apartheid research.

"Raesetje Sefala, a researcher at...DAIR, said her organisation has observed that townships are still expanding. “They continue to resemble their appearance during the apartheid era, indicating that similar small land sizes are still being allocated,” she told Al Jazeera."
